It helps frontline clinicians present better care for patients with complex illnesses.

The ECHO(r) model facilitates case-based learning and provides support to members through a hub-and-spoke knowledge-sharing methodology. Its success lies in bringing best practices in health care to underserved populations through principal care suppliers. In addition to diabetes, this program also facilitates primary care for other sophisticated chronic conditions. That enables services to learn about new solutions, improve quality of maintenance, and reduce the burden on their community.

In complexes that have been customarily underserved simply by health care, the ECHO style exponentially increases the workforce’s capacity to apply best practice techniques. Their telementoring model gets rid of the need for costly supervision.

Using a video-based program, the ECHO(r) program provides training to participants in a facilitated, guided practice setting. Experienced mentors from a “hub” site conduct virtual treatment centers with community providers. The sessions incorporate a didactic display, clinical circumstance discussion, and recommendations for treatment. Those unable to sign up for the periods may participate via Zoom lens.

Since it developed in 2003, Project ECHO has broadened across the United states of america and more than 34 countries. Its target is to contact one billion dollars lives simply by 2025.

Additionally to featuring treatment, Project ECHO as well educates clinicians on the most beneficial treatment options with regards to chronic diseases and mental disorder. It helps primary care for cancers, diabetes, and substance work with disorders.
